Monitor Not Displaying On Boot-Up While Installing Windows 10
My PC came with Windows 11 Pro pre-installed and while it was fine for a month I started to have some issues and wanted to go back to windows 10. I used the Installation Media option from https://www.microsoft.com/en-us/software-download/windows10 and everything was going fine up until it started the process of restarting my computer a few times while installing. I believe the percentage was around 80% or so when it restarted another time, but this time my monitor no longer was picking up anything that the PC was showing after about half an hour of waiting to see if it just needed a bit more time.
I know that the problem isn't the monitor itself or the HDMI cable since its still able to pick up my older computer just fine. The PC I was installing Windows 10 on turns on just fine, but it's just that nothing is registering on my monitor to even know where to start trying to fix it. Any advice would be appreciated.
